#d562ec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d562ec is composed of 83.5% red, 38.4%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.7% cyan, 58.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 290 degrees, a saturation of 78.4% and a lightness of 65.5%. #d562ec color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c4ff with #ab00d9.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

Shades and Tints of #d562ec
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#faeef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#d562ec
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a8a6a8 is the less saturated color, while #de54fa is the most saturated one.
